A lavishly illustrated collection of on-the-spot and authoritative surveys of current theatrical activity from across the globe, this work covers the three seasons from 1999-2000, 2000-1 and 2001-2.
The latest edition of "World of Theatre" offers a close-up view of the most significant productions and theatre trends in over 60 countries. Covering the past three seasons, from 1999-2000 to 2001-2002, the fully illustrated volume explores the diversity of the current global dramatic scene, ranging from magisterial round-ups by leading critics in Europe and North America to what are sometimes literally reports from the battlefield in war-torn countries such as Congo or Yugoslavia.
The "World of Theatre" is published under the auspices of the International Theatre Institute (ITI), an international non-governmental organization (NGO) that was founded by UNESCO and the international theatre community in Prague in 1948.
